<?php namespace ProcessWire;

/**
 * ProcessWire InputfieldWrapper
 *
 * ProcessWire 3.x, Copyright 2022 by Ryan Cramer
 * https://processwire.com
 *
 * About InputfieldWrapper
 * =======================
 * A type of Inputfield that is designed specifically to wrap other Inputfields.
 * The most common example of an InputfieldWrapper is a <form>.
 * 
 * #pw-summary A type of Inputfield that contains other Inputfield objects as children. Commonly a form or a fieldset.  
 *
 * InputfieldWrapper is not designed to render an Inputfield specifically, but you can set a value attribute
 * containing content that will be rendered before the wrapper.
 *

    /**
     * Insert one Inputfield before one that’s already there.
     * 
     * Note: string or array values for either argument require 3.0.196+. 
     * 
     * ~~~~~
     * // example 1: Get existing Inputfields and insert first_name before last_name
     * $firstName = $form->getByName('first_name');
     * $lastName = $form->getByName('last_name'); 
     * $form->insertBefore($firstName, $lastName); 
     * 
     * // example 2: Same as above but use Inputfield names (3.0.196+)
     * $form->insertBefore('first_name', 'last_name'); 
     * 
     * // example 3: Create new Inputfield and insert before last_name (3.0.196+)
     * $form->insertBefore([ 'type' => 'text', 'name' => 'first_name' ], 'last_name'); 
     * ~~~~~
     * 
     * #pw-group-manipulation
     * 
     * @param Inputfield|array|string $item Item to insert 
     * @param Inputfield|string $existingItem Existing item you want to insert before.
     * @return $this
     *
     */
    public function insertBefore($item, $existingItem) {
        return $this->insert($item, $existingItem, true);
    }

    /**
     * Insert one Inputfield after one that’s already there.
     * 
     * Note: string or array values for either argument require 3.0.196+.
     * 
     * ~~~~~
     * // example 1: Get existing Inputfields, insert last_name after first_name
     * $lastName = $form->getByName('last_name');
     * $firstName = $form->getByName('first_name');
     * $form->insertAfter($lastName, $firstName);
     *
     * // example 2: Same as above but use Inputfield names (3.0.196+)
     * $form->insertBefore('last_name', 'first_name');
     *
     * // example 3: Create new Inputfield and insert after first_name (3.0.196+)
     * $form->insertAfter([ 'type' => 'text', 'name' => 'last_name' ], 'first_name');
     * ~~~~~
     * 
     * #pw-group-manipulation
     * 
     * @param Inputfield|array|string $item Item to insert
     * @param Inputfield|string $existingItem Existing item you want to insert after.
     * @return $this
     *
     */
    public function insertAfter($item, $existingItem) {
        return $this->insert($item, $existingItem, false);
    }

    /**
     * Import an array of Inputfield definitions to to this InputfieldWrapper instance
     *
     * Your array should be an array of associative arrays, with each element describing an Inputfield.
     * The following properties are required for each Inputfield definition: 
     * 
     * - `type` Which Inputfield module to use (may optionally exclude the "Inputfield" prefix). 
     * - `name` Name attribute to use for the Inputfield. 
     * - `label` Text label that appears above the Inputfield. 
     * 
     * ~~~~~
     * // Example array for Inputfield definitions
     * array(
     *   array(
     *     'name' => 'fullname',
     *     'type' => 'text',
     *     'label' => 'Field label'
     *     'columnWidth' => 50,
     *     'required' => true,
     *   ),
     *   array(
     *     'name' => 'color',
     *     'type' => 'select',
     *     'label' => 'Your favorite color',
     *     'description' => 'Select your favorite color or leave blank if you do not have one.',
     *     'columnWidth' => 50,
     *     'options' => array(
     *        'red' => 'Brilliant Red',
     *        'orange' => 'Citrus Orange',
     *        'blue' => 'Sky Blue'
     *     )
     *   ),
     *   // alternative usage: associative array where name attribute is specified as key
     *   'my_fieldset' => array(
     *     'type' => 'fieldset',
     *     'label' => 'My Fieldset',
     *     'children' => array(
     *       'some_field' => array(
     *         'type' => 'text',
     *         'label' => 'Some Field',
     *       )
     *     )
     * );
     * // Note: you may alternatively use associative arrays where the keys are assumed to 
     * // be the 'name' attribute.See the last item 'my_fieldset' above for an example. 
     * ~~~~~
     * 
     * #pw-group-manipulation
     *
     * @param array $a Array of Inputfield definitions
     * @param InputfieldWrapper $inputfields Specify the wrapper you want them added to, or omit to use current.
     * @return $this
     *
     */
    public function importArray(array $a, InputfieldWrapper $inputfields = null) {
        
        $modules = $this->wire()->modules;
        
        if(is_null($inputfields)) $inputfields = $this; 
        if(!count($a)) return $inputfields;
    
        // if just a single field definition rather than an array of them, normalize to array of array
        $first = reset($a); 
        if(!is_array($first)) $a = array($a); 
        
        foreach($a as $name => $info) {

            if(isset($info['name'])) {
                $name = $info['name'];
                unset($info['name']);
            }

            if(!isset($info['type'])) {
                $this->error("Skipped field '$name' because no 'type' is set");
                continue;
            }

            $type = $info['type'];
            unset($info['type']);
            if(strpos($type, 'Inputfield') !== 0) $type = "Inputfield" . ucfirst($type);
            
            /** @var Inputfield $f */
            $f = $modules->get($type);

            if(!$f) {
                $this->error("Skipped field '$name' because module '$type' does not exist");
                continue;
            }
            
            $f->attr('name', $name);
            
            if($type === 'InputfieldCheckbox') {
                // checkbox behaves a little differently, just like in HTML
                /** @var InputfieldCheckbox $f */
                if(!empty($info['attr']['value'])) {
                    $f->attr('value', $info['attr']['value']);
                } else if(!empty($info['value'])) {
                    $f->attr('value', $info['value']);
                }
                unset($info['attr']['value'], $info['value']);
                $f->autocheck = 1; // future value attr set triggers checked state
            }

            if(isset($info['attr']) && is_array($info['attr'])) {
                foreach($info['attr'] as $key => $value) {
                    $f->attr($key, $value);
                }
                unset($a['attr']);
            }

            foreach($info as $key => $value) {
                if($key == 'children') continue;
                $f->$key = $value;
            }

            if($f instanceof InputfieldWrapper && !empty($info['children'])) {
                $this->importArray($info['children'], $f);
            }

            $inputfields->add($f);
        }

        return $inputfields;
    }

    /**
     * Populate values for all Inputfields in this wrapper from the given $data object or array.
     * 
     * This iterates through every field in this InputfieldWrapper and looks for field names 
     * that are also present in the given object or array. If present, it uses them to populate
     * the associated Inputfield. 
     * 
     * If given an array, it should be an associative with the field 'name' as the keys and
     * the field 'value' as the array value, i.e. `['field_name' => 'field_value']`.
     * 
     * #pw-group-manipulation
     * 
     * @param WireData|Wire|ConfigurableModule|array $data
     * @return array Returns array of field names that were populated
     * 
     */
    public function populateValues($data) {
        $populated = array();
        foreach($this->getAll() as $inputfield) {
            if($inputfield instanceof InputfieldWrapper) continue; 
            $name = $inputfield->attr('name');
            if(!$name) continue;
            $value = null;
            if(is_array($data)) {
                // array
                $value = isset($data[$name]) ? $data[$name] : null;
            } else if($data instanceof WireData) {
                // WireData object
                $value = $data->data($name);
            } else if(is_object($data)) {
                // Wire or other object with __get() implemented
                $value = $data->$name;
            } 
            if($value === null) continue;
            if($inputfield instanceof InputfieldCheckbox) $inputfield->autocheck = 1; 
            $inputfield->attr('value', $value);
            $populated[$name] = $name;
        }
        return $populated;
    }
